You would have thought Charles Leclerc did enough to impress his employers in his first season with the Italian team. The youngster came into Ferrari and showed his four-time world champion teammate how to drive and beat him on points, finishing the season on 264 points compared to the German's 240. However, Ferrari are going to continue to favor Sebastian Vettel in 2020.
Mattia Binotto has said that the Ferrari car has been designed and built around Vettel's driving style and many have been left to think that Leclerc has just been massively insulted by the team he works for.
When Lewis Hamilton came into Formula 1 and immediately challenged his world champion teammate Fernando Alonso, McLaren would have done anything for him. Ferrari are instead stuck in the past and for some reason are struggling to see that Leclerc is the future.
“We will design a car that is more in line with Sebastian's driving style. With more downward pressure on the back,” Binotto said to Motorsport.com.
The Ferrari boss went on to try and explain his decision.
ADVERTISEMENT
“The lack of downforce resulted in more speed, but that did not work out as hoped. Seb had more trouble with the car than Charles, especially at the start of the season. After the summer break, it was better because we made adjustments to the car.
“Vettel is definitely a driver who is at the heart of our project. He is the most experienced and knows the team well. His feedback is very important and Leclerc has learned a lot from it."
